Peninsula Art League Presents International Art Exhibition
150 paintings are on display at the Gig Harbor History Museum thru Oct. 5
(Gig Harbor) Gig Harbor’s 11th annual open juried art exhibition is currently on display at the Harbor History Museum. The show is presented by Peninsula Art League.
More than 300 entries were received from artists throughout the U. S. and Canada. Juror Joe Garcia, an internationally known painter, selected 150 artworks for the show.
A dark, moody portrait of a woman by California oil painter Zin Lim won the Best of Show award. Garcia said that the unique perspective of the portrait – in profile rather than face-forward – drew him to the painting. “It’s totally different from what you expect a portrait to be – it doesn’t stare back at you when you look at it,” he said. “And technically, it’s very, very good. The brush strokes in the hair are very well done – almost transparent. And you can just imagine the story it tells.”
Garcia selected another oil – a painting of two women in bathing suits on a beach by Gig Harbor artist Lynda Lindner – for the First Place-Painting award, and an almost surreal shot of a lily as the First Place-Photography winner. Other prizes were awarded by local businesses.
One final award has yet to be announced: the People’s Choice award will be presented Oct. 4 at 1pm. Voting continues through noon Oct. 3 in the main gallery of the museum. “We hope that everyone who visits the show will take time to vote for their favorite artwork,” said show co-chair Sheila Anderson.
